Released in 1958, “Nobody” is a ballad that delves into the depths of love and longing, exploring the profound impact one person can have on another’s life. Twitty’s vocals shine throughout the song, imbuing each lyric with an emotional depth that resonates deeply with listeners.

The song’s opening lines paint a vivid picture of isolation and loneliness: “You’re nobody with no one to care / You’re nobody with no one to share.” These poignant words set the stage for the narrator’s revelation: despite feeling insignificant and alone, they are everything to someone special.

The chorus of “Nobody” is a powerful declaration of love’s transformative power: “You’re nobody to no one but me.” This simple yet profound statement encapsulates the essence of the song, conveying the idea that love can elevate even the most ordinary individual to a place of immense worth.

As the song progresses, the narrator elaborates on the ways in which their beloved has enriched their life. They are the source of dreams, memories, and laughter, the one person who truly understands and cherishes them.

The bridge of “Nobody” takes a poignant turn, acknowledging the fragility of life and the importance of cherishing every moment with loved ones. The narrator sings, “No one to all when you’re alone / No one to be your very own,” emphasizing the preciousness of companionship and the devastating impact of its loss.

The song concludes on a hopeful note, reaffirming the narrator’s unwavering devotion to their beloved. They declare, “And darlin’, that someone is me,” underscoring the depth and permanence of their love.
